Gin & Tonic Varadero Recipe

Time10m
Serves1

Hendrick's Original Gin, mediterranean tonic water, lemon, olive and fresh rosemary.

Method

Preparation

1

Prepare the Glass

Begin by selecting a highball or Collins glass. Fill it with ice cubes to chill.

2

Squeeze Lemon Juice

Cut the lemon in half. Squeeze the juice of half the lemon into the glass over the ice. Reserve the other half for garnish.

3

Add Gin

Pour 2 oz of Hendrick's Original Gin over the ice and lemon juice in the glass.

4

Add Tonic Water

Slowly pour 4 oz of Mediterranean tonic water into the glass, allowing it to mix gently with the gin.

5

Garnish

Thread 3 olives onto a cocktail pick and place it in the drink. Then, take a sprig of fresh rosemary and lightly slap it between your palms to release its aroma before placing it in the drink as well.

6

Final Touch

Cut a slice from the remaining lemon half and place it on the rim of the glass for an extra garnish.
